This litigation was precipitated in 1971 when the Legislature raised the gross production tax on oil and gas from 5% to 7%. 68 O.S. 1971, Sec. 1001(a). Continental Oil Company (Petitioner) and LVO Corporation and Occidental Petroleum Corporation, Intervenors (hereinafter collectively called Continental), paid the 7% gross production tax on their production under protest and filed complaints with the State...
